The 1984 Pacific Coast Athletic Association men's basketball tournament (now known as the Big West Conference men's basketball tournament) was held March 8–10 at The Forum in Inglewood, California.

Third-seeded Fresno State upset top-seeded, defending champions UNLV in the final, 51–49, thus capturing their third PCAA/Big West title (and third in four seasons).

The Bulldogs, in turn, received a bid to the 1984 NCAA tournament, the program's third overall. UNLV, PCAA tournament runners-up, were also included in the NCAA field.
